EA Sports Web App Change Password Secure & Simple

EA Sports web app change password is crucial for maintaining account security. This guide delves into the essential elements of a smooth and secure password reset process, from UI enhancements to robust security measures and a user-friendly experience. We’ll explore the technical underpinnings and user considerations, ensuring a positive and accessible journey for all users.

The updated interface will feature intuitive password input fields with visual feedback, guiding users toward strong, unique passwords. Security enhancements will prioritize multi-factor authentication, offering users a variety of secure options. Accessibility and usability are paramount, guaranteeing a seamless experience across all devices. Technical implementation details and user feedback integration will round out this comprehensive look at the process.

User Interface (UI) Changes

The EA Sports web app password reset process is crucial for user experience and security. Modernizing the UI can significantly improve user satisfaction and trust. This revamp prioritizes both ease of use and enhanced security measures.

Password Reset Flow Enhancements

The current password reset flow often involves simple input fields. However, a more sophisticated approach can significantly improve the user experience. Visual cues, feedback, and security measures can be integrated to create a more user-friendly and secure process.

Current UI Element Potential Future UI Element Description Visual Example (No Link Required)
Password Input Field Secure Password Input Field with visual feedback Show strength indicators, prevent input of easily guessable passwords A field with a progress bar indicating password strength, highlighting weak password attempts. A visual cue, perhaps a color change, could signal potentially harmful characters or patterns in the input.
Confirmation Message Dynamic Confirmation Message Provide real-time feedback on password validity and potential issues Instead of a static “Password reset successful,” a message might dynamically adjust based on the password’s strength, e.g., “Strong password reset successful!” or “Password is too simple. Please try again.”
Error Handling Intuitive Error Messaging Clear and concise error messages guide users through the process. Instead of a generic “Error,” the message might specify the issue, e.g., “Incorrect email address,” or “Password reset link expired.”

Mobile-First Design Considerations

A mobile-first design approach for the password reset flow is highly beneficial. The approach focuses on creating a seamless experience across different devices, with particular attention to touch-screen interactions.

  • Responsive design is essential. The interface should adapt seamlessly to various screen sizes, ensuring readability and usability on smartphones, tablets, and desktops.
  • Simplified navigation is critical. The steps to reset a password should be clear and easy to follow, even with limited screen space.
  • Optimized input methods are important. Password fields should be optimized for touch input, minimizing the need for complex gestures. Consider incorporating auto-complete or other relevant features to speed up the process.

Security Enhancements

Ea sports web app change password

Protecting user accounts is paramount in today’s digital landscape, especially for online gaming platforms. Robust security measures are essential to ensure the integrity and safety of user data, preventing unauthorized access and maintaining trust. This section delves into critical security considerations for password resets on the EA Sports web application.Password resets are a common user interaction. However, they present a security vulnerability if not handled with the utmost care.

A poorly designed reset process can lead to account compromises and data breaches. This discussion Artikels strategies to enhance security during the password reset procedure, emphasizing multi-factor authentication (MFA) as a crucial component.

Multi-Factor Authentication for Password Resets

Implementing multi-factor authentication (MFA) for password resets is a significant step towards enhancing security. This added layer of verification significantly reduces the risk of unauthorized access, even if a password is compromised. MFA demands more than just a password; it requires a second form of verification, making it harder for attackers to gain control of an account.

Different MFA Methods

Various MFA methods are available for password resets. Each method presents a unique trade-off between security and user experience. Comparing and contrasting these methods is crucial for selecting the optimal approach for the EA Sports web application.

  • Time-based one-time passwords (TOTP): These use a time-sensitive code generated by an authenticator app. This method is highly secure, as the code changes frequently. The user experience involves using a dedicated authenticator app, which is a standard for many secure services.
  • Push notifications: This method leverages a mobile device to receive a notification requesting confirmation for the password reset. The security relies on the device’s security and the user’s vigilance. The user experience is generally convenient and seamless, as it is a common interaction in modern mobile apps.
  • Email-based one-time codes: A one-time code is sent to the registered email address. This approach balances security with user familiarity, although email accounts are susceptible to compromise. The user experience is straightforward, as it uses existing communication channels.

Secure Password Reset Token Generation

Generating secure password reset tokens is crucial for the overall security of the system. These tokens act as temporary credentials for password updates, and their security directly impacts user account safety.

  • Random Number Generation: Utilizing strong random number generators is vital. These generators produce unpredictable sequences of characters, making it difficult for attackers to guess the token.
  • Token Expiration: Setting an expiration time for the token is essential. This ensures that the token is only valid for a limited period, reducing the window of opportunity for unauthorized access.
  • Cryptographic Hashing: Hashing the token with a strong algorithm, like SHA-256, enhances its security by making it virtually impossible to reverse-engineer.

Password Reset Methods Comparison

The table below illustrates the different password reset methods, highlighting their security levels and user experiences.

Method Description Security Level User Experience
Email Reset Link A link is sent to the registered email address. Medium Easy to use, but prone to phishing
TOTP A time-sensitive code generated by an authenticator app. High Requires a dedicated app, but very secure
Push Notification A notification is sent to the user’s mobile device. High Convenient, but depends on device security
SMS Code A one-time code is sent via SMS. Medium Easy to use, but SMS security can be a concern

Accessibility and Usability

Password resets are a critical part of a smooth user experience. Making this process accessible and intuitive is paramount, not just for convenience, but for ensuring everyone can regain access to their accounts. A user-friendly password reset system fosters trust and reliability.A seamless password reset process reduces frustration and improves user satisfaction. Clear communication and straightforward steps are key to this.

A well-designed system will help users regain access quickly and efficiently. This ensures the system remains a valuable resource for users of all abilities.

Best Practices for Accessible Password Reset Processes

A robust password reset system considers the needs of diverse users. Accessibility features are not just a “nice-to-have” but a critical element for inclusivity. Following these best practices helps ensure a positive and equitable user experience.

  • Use clear and concise language. Avoid jargon and overly technical terms. Employ simple, direct language that is easily understandable by all users. Using a simple, straightforward language approach enhances the user experience for all, including those with language barriers.
  • Provide alternative text for visual elements. All visual elements, including buttons, forms, and images, should have descriptive alternative text. This ensures that users with visual impairments can understand the purpose and function of each element. Screen readers will then provide clear and concise information, ensuring that visual information is converted into easily understood auditory cues.
  • Offer multiple authentication methods. Providing alternative authentication methods, like email or SMS, is important for users who might have difficulty with one method. This provides redundancy and caters to diverse user needs.
  • Ensure keyboard navigation works effectively. Users who rely on a keyboard should be able to easily navigate through the entire password reset process without any issues. This ensures that the password reset process is navigable and easily accessible for those who rely on the keyboard.
  • Offer adjustable font sizes. Users with visual impairments or other needs may require larger fonts or alternative text sizes. This ensures that the password reset process is adaptable and accommodates diverse user preferences.

Clear and Concise Instructions for Password Resets

Clear and concise instructions are essential for guiding users through the password reset process. A user should easily understand the steps required to regain access. This directly impacts user satisfaction.

  • Use a step-by-step approach. Guide users through the process in a clear, sequential manner, ensuring that each step is easy to understand and follow. This ensures that users can progress through the reset process without difficulty.
  • Use visual cues and indicators. Employ visual cues, such as progress bars or checkmarks, to indicate progress through the reset process. These visual cues help users stay engaged and track their progress through the process. This helps users understand where they are in the reset process.
  • Provide immediate feedback. Users should receive instant feedback on each step, such as confirmation messages or error messages. This is important for users to quickly know if they are progressing correctly or if they need to correct an error.

Examples of Alternative Text for Visual Elements

Using descriptive alternative text for visual elements is critical for accessibility. This ensures that screen readers and other assistive technologies can accurately convey the information.

  • Example 1: Button: “Reset Password” (Alternative text: “Click here to reset your password”)
  • Example 2: Image: A lock icon (Alternative text: “Password security lock”)
  • Example 3: Form field: “New Password” (Alternative text: “Enter your new password in the field below”)

Potential Usability Issues Related to Password Resets

Understanding potential issues helps anticipate and address problems before they affect users.

  • Complex processes. Complex processes can confuse users and lead to errors. A simple process is key to a user-friendly system.
  • Inconsistent formatting across devices. Variations in formatting across different devices can cause usability issues. Consistent formatting is critical for a seamless experience.
  • Slow response times. Slow response times can be frustrating for users. A quick response time is a key element of usability.

Ensuring a Consistent User Experience Across Devices

Maintaining consistency in the user experience across different devices is crucial. This ensures a smooth experience, regardless of how users access the system.

  • Use responsive design principles. Using responsive design ensures the site adapts to various screen sizes and devices, maintaining a consistent layout and functionality.
  • Provide clear and concise instructions on all devices. Ensure that the reset instructions are readily available and easy to understand on all devices.
  • Maintain consistent branding and visual elements. Consistency in branding and visual elements reinforces brand identity and enhances user recognition.

The Role of User Feedback in Improving the Password Reset Process

Collecting user feedback is crucial for identifying areas for improvement. This feedback is key to enhancing the user experience.

  • Implement feedback mechanisms. Use feedback forms, surveys, and other mechanisms to collect user input on the password reset process. Gathering this information will help determine areas for improvement.
  • Analyze user feedback. Carefully analyze user feedback to identify patterns and recurring issues. Analyze the data for common issues.
  • Use feedback to make improvements. Implement changes based on the analysis of user feedback to create a more user-friendly experience.

Technical Implementation: Ea Sports Web App Change Password

Return to web store without logging in

Crafting a robust password reset system for the EA Sports web application requires a meticulous approach. This involves not only the user interface but also the intricate backend processes, secure data handling, and thorough testing. A well-designed reset system ensures a smooth experience for users while maintaining the highest security standards.Implementing a password reset feature hinges on a series of well-defined steps.

The key components involve handling user requests, generating secure tokens, verifying user identity, and updating the database. This careful execution prevents security breaches and maintains user trust.

Backend Processes

The backend processes for password reset requests are critical. These processes manage user authentication, token generation, and database updates. The system must be able to identify valid users requesting a reset. A secure token generation process is vital, ensuring the token is unique and short-lived. A database update process for password changes must be carefully constructed to maintain data integrity.

Secure Data Handling Practices, Ea sports web app change password

Protecting user data is paramount. Secure data handling practices are essential for safeguarding password reset tokens. Tokens should be generated using strong cryptographic algorithms and stored securely. The lifetime of these tokens should be limited, and they should be invalidated after a specified period or after successful use. A crucial aspect involves implementing robust mechanisms for handling potential vulnerabilities and protecting against token theft.

For example, consider using HTTPS for all communications to encrypt the data transmission.

Error Handling and Feedback

Error handling and feedback mechanisms are vital for a user-friendly experience. The system should provide clear and concise error messages to users, guiding them through the process. If a user enters an invalid email address, a specific message should be displayed. Clear feedback during the password reset process helps users understand the system’s response.

Testing the Password Reset Functionality

Thorough testing ensures the reliability and security of the password reset functionality. A comprehensive test plan should cover various scenarios, including valid and invalid user requests, token generation, and database updates. The process must also be tested against various types of potential attacks. For example, testing with different browsers and devices can reveal compatibility issues. Test cases should be designed to identify potential security flaws and weaknesses.

Implementing Password Reset Functionality Procedure

The password reset functionality implementation should follow a well-defined procedure. This procedure should detail each step involved in processing a password reset request, from initial user input to final database update.

  • User Request: The user initiates the password reset process by entering their email address.
  • Token Generation: A unique, short-lived token is generated and associated with the user’s email address. This token should have a limited time validity, preventing unauthorized access.
  • Token Delivery: The token is securely delivered to the user via email. The email should clearly explain how to use the token to reset their password.
  • Password Reset: The user navigates to a secure page using the token, enters a new password, and confirms the change.
  • Database Update: The user’s password in the database is updated with the new password.
  • Token Invalidation: The token is invalidated to prevent further use.

User Experience (UX) Considerations

Ea sports web app change password

A seamless password reset process is crucial for maintaining user trust and satisfaction. A smooth, intuitive experience minimizes frustration and encourages users to return. It’s about more than just functionality; it’s about crafting a positive and empowering interaction.A well-designed password reset process should be as user-friendly as possible. It should prioritize ease of use and minimize any steps that might confuse or intimidate the user.

The goal is to empower users to regain access to their accounts quickly and effortlessly.

Importance of a Positive User Experience

A positive user experience (UX) during password resets directly impacts user satisfaction and retention. A smooth and straightforward process fosters trust and confidence in the platform. Conversely, a cumbersome or confusing process can lead to frustration, potentially causing users to abandon the reset attempt or even the platform altogether. A well-designed experience reduces support inquiries and strengthens user loyalty.

Designing a Clear and Concise Password Reset Flow

A clear password reset flow streamlines the process for users. Start by presenting a clear and concise method to initiate the reset. This might involve providing a link or a button prominently displayed. Subsequent steps should be logically organized, each step clearly communicated with minimal ambiguity. For instance, a reset email should contain clear instructions and a straightforward link.

Avoid unnecessary form fields or complex verification steps.

Providing Appropriate Feedback to the User

Providing timely and informative feedback throughout the reset process is essential. This involves clear messages at each stage, confirming the user’s actions and providing progress updates. For example, an animated progress bar during a time-consuming operation or a confirmation message after a successful password change. This feedback builds confidence and transparency.

Mitigating User Frustration and Anxiety

Anticipate potential points of friction and proactively address them. For instance, if a user enters an incorrect email address repeatedly, provide helpful error messages and suggestions. A helpful error message, like “Please double-check the email address,” can significantly reduce frustration. Consider offering alternative methods for password recovery, such as using security questions.

User Flow Diagram for the Password Reset Process

Step Action User Feedback
1 User initiates password reset. Confirmation message displayed, or an email sent to the user’s account.
2 User receives password reset email. Email with clear instructions and a secure link.
3 User clicks the link. Confirmation of the link’s activation, or a loading message.
4 User enters new password. Feedback on password strength (optional), and a confirmation message.
5 User confirms the new password. Confirmation message confirming the successful change.
6 User logs in with the new password. Successful login message.

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top
close
close